[[File:Game selector.png|thumb|This is what will appear once you have opened the game selection menu!]]&lt;br /&gt;
PlayUHC has a variety of game modes, all unique in their own way. They are available on the Game Selector in the Hub, just right click while holding the compass.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Players can play game modes on Minecraft versions 1.8 and even 1.20!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
__TOC__&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== UHC Game Modes ==&lt;br /&gt;
These are the regular game modes that you can find on the Game Selector. In the lobby of these games, there is a helpful &amp;quot;InfoBook&amp;quot; in your inventory that provides more detailed information as well as Tips and Tricks!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Creative Rush ===&lt;br /&gt;
The game starts in creative mode for 20 seconds. You will have five minutes to prepare for a meetup!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 10 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Cut Clean U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
Autosmelt and autocook help make the game smoother!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 45 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Dragon Rush ===&lt;br /&gt;
Kill the Ender Dragon! You find endermen, blazes, and strongholds all over the place in the overworld! Get arrows from gravel, craft 4 eyes of ender and use them to open a portal that you can find by using the eyes of ender!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 30 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Dragon Rush PvE ===&lt;br /&gt;
Like Dragon Rush, but without PvP!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 30 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Dragon Rush Vanilla ===&lt;br /&gt;
Kill the Ender Dragon! Go to the nether to obtain blaze rods for the eyes of ender. Only one stronghold spawns in the world filled with eight eyes of ender: Use eyes of ender to find it!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 120 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Duels ===&lt;br /&gt;
Duel another player in a UHC arena.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Enchanting U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
All players start with 64 Enchantment Tables, 64 Anvils, 128 Bookshelves, and 10,000 XP Levels. Ore Vein Miner is enabled.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 20 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Explosive U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
Everyone spawns with a stack of TNT. TNT auto-ignites when placed. Mobs explode 3 seconds after you kill them!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length:  30 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Flower Power ===&lt;br /&gt;
Break flowers and dead bushes to get random items and EXP! Enchanting and brewing are two main aspects of this game!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 20 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== God U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
Your God Pickaxe will guide you through a world filled with ores. Get tons of diamonds and gold, and craft insanely OP God Apples!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 10 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Gone Fishing ===&lt;br /&gt;
Use your fishing rod to get random items that you will use to defeat your opponents in a meetup!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 10 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Meetup ===&lt;br /&gt;
The quickest and simplest UHC match: you spawn with gear, and you kill all your opponents!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 5 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Moles U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
One person on each team can be automatically chosen to be the Mole.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The Moles team can communicate with each other, and their objective is to take out other players! &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The moles are picked when PvP is enabled. Friendly Fire is ON!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 45 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Mystery Scenarios ===&lt;br /&gt;
A game with the following permanently enabled scenarios: Cut Clean, Golden Heads, Hastey Boys, Mystery Scenarios, and Timber.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Mystery Scenarios randomly picks 5 additional scenarios that change every 10 minutes!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 45 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Mystery Speed ===&lt;br /&gt;
Same as Speed UHC, but 5 scenarios are randomly picked and they will change every 5 minutes!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 20 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Randomizer U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
All item drops are random, including those dropping from breaking chests and other containers!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 20 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Red Rover ===&lt;br /&gt;
Two teams battle each other in 1 player vs 1 player battles.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Red vs Blue ===&lt;br /&gt;
Two teams against each other in a simple and quick Meetup match!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 5 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Scenario Madness ===&lt;br /&gt;
Vote between [[Scenarios|60+ scenarios]]! The top 3 voted scenarios will be in the game, plus a bonus scenario that will be picked randomly!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 45 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Scrambled Craft U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
All crafting recipes, except crafting table, dyes from flowers, planks and sticks are scrambled!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 20 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Sonic U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
Permanent speed 3 effect, a diamond pickaxe with efficiency 5, triple ores and several scenarios make getting resources in this mode incredibly fast!&lt;br /&gt;
Cow rooms spawn underground to help you with enchanting.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ical Game length: 10 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Speed U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
You have a permanent speed effect, your pickaxes will have Efficiency 3 and Ore Vein Miner is enabled.&lt;br /&gt;
Cow rooms spawn underground to help you with enchanting.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 20 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Survival Games U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
Up to 24 players fight against each other with the items they can find in the chests placed around the map!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
An airdrop chest drops from the sky. Locate it with a compass!&lt;br /&gt;
At 6 minutes into the game, the border will quickly shrink towards the center.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 10 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Vanilla UHC ===&lt;br /&gt;
The most classic and basic UHC game!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 45 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Wither Rush ===&lt;br /&gt;
The overworld is being invaded by the Nether: Wither Skeletons wander around the overworld, building underground Nether bases to prepare for the invasion. There is only one way to stop them: summon and kill a Wither boss!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 30 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Other Game Modes ==&lt;br /&gt;
Game modes that players can stil enjoy!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Free-for-all Arena ===&lt;br /&gt;
Commonly called FFA Arena, this is an always-on battle arena that you can keep playing indefinitely.&lt;br /&gt;
Players spawn with gears, and they have infinite lives. They do not regenerate life naturally. Killing players will make them drop a Golden Apple, a head, and 8 golden ingots. Golden Heads can be crafted.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Additionally, the killer&#039;s flint and steel will be restored to its original durability and there is a chance for an enchantment to be applied to their armor.&lt;/div&gt;</summary>

&lt;div&gt;[[File:Custom Games Settings GUI.png|thumb|Custom Games Settings|A screenshot of the Scenario Madness&#039; Custom Games Settings GUI]]&lt;br /&gt;
Custom Games gives players the ability of making their own customised UHC games easily.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Players can get access to Custom Games with the [[Ranks|Titan or Content Creator ranks]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
While hosting a Custom Game, the game creator has a special Host chat prefix.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
__TOC__&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Features ==&lt;br /&gt;
* Easy and quick: hosts change settings from ingame GUIs. No need to edit config files or read guides!&lt;br /&gt;
* Anti-cheat: our powerful custom-made anti-cheat system can detect most of the cheats used.&lt;br /&gt;
* Moderation tools: you have access to banning and muting any player in your custom game!&lt;br /&gt;
* Staff help: PlayUHC&#039;s staff is available to help you, just contact them with &#039;&#039;&#039;/helpop&#039;&#039;&#039; or on our &#039;&#039;&#039;Discord #support&#039;&#039;&#039; channel&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== How to create a custom game ==&lt;br /&gt;
# Join PlayUHC&#039;s hub.&lt;br /&gt;
# Right click the compass in your hand (&amp;quot;Game Selector&amp;quot;).&lt;br /&gt;
# Choose a [[Game_Modes|game mode]]. Usually, Scenario Madness is used for UHC games.&lt;br /&gt;
# Click the sign item (&amp;quot;Custom Game&amp;quot;).&lt;br /&gt;
# Set up the game settings, like team size, border size, etc. These settings may vary depending on the game mode!&lt;br /&gt;
# Click the green glass pane (&amp;quot;Start!&amp;quot;). The server will be created and it will load. It usually takes about 20 seconds. You and everyone in your [[Party_System|party]] will be teleported to your custom game once it&#039;s loaded.&lt;br /&gt;
# After you&#039;re on your custom game server, you can edit the [[Scenarios|scenarios]] with &#039;&#039;&#039;/scen&#039;&#039;&#039;&lt;br /&gt;
# When you&#039;re ready, start the game with &#039;&#039;&#039;/start&#039;&#039;&#039;. This will start a 30 seconds countdown. Alternatively, you can use &#039;&#039;&#039;/start [seconds]&#039;&#039;&#039; for a countdown of the specified seconds.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Host Commands ==&lt;br /&gt;
The host can use the following custom commands:&lt;br /&gt;
* /scen: view and edit scenarios&lt;br /&gt;
* /start [countdown seconds]: starts the game&lt;br /&gt;
* /start pause: to pause the start countdown&lt;br /&gt;
* /stop: stops the server and teleports everyone back to the hub. It asks for confirmation.&lt;br /&gt;
* /aban (player): bans the specified player from your game&lt;br /&gt;
* /amute (player): mutes the specified player in your game&lt;br /&gt;
* /aunban (player): unbans the specified player&lt;br /&gt;
* /aunmute (player): unmutes the specified player&lt;br /&gt;
* /abans: shows the currently banned players&lt;br /&gt;
* /amutes: shows the currently muted players&lt;br /&gt;
* /muteall: toggle mute all players except the host and moderators&lt;br /&gt;
* /broadcast (message): broadcasts a message in chat&lt;br /&gt;
* /setscoreboardtitle (new title): changes the title in the sidebar&lt;br /&gt;
* /specchat (message): sends a message to the spectators chat&lt;br /&gt;
* /maxplayers (number of players): the maximum number of players that can join the server&lt;br /&gt;
* /latescatter (player): late scatters a player that is not in the game yet&lt;br /&gt;
* /respawn (player): respawns a player that died&lt;br /&gt;
* /respawn (player) true: respawns a player that died along with the items they died with&lt;br /&gt;
* /time set (Time): changes the time to meetup countdown&lt;br /&gt;
* /setborder (Size) [Speed in blocks per second]: changes the border size. If the optional speed parameter is omitted, the default or previously used speed value will be used instead.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Additionally, the following Minecraft vanilla commands can be used:&lt;br /&gt;
* /difficulty&lt;br /&gt;
* /me&lt;br /&gt;
* /spreadplayers&lt;br /&gt;
* /tellraw&lt;br /&gt;
* /title&lt;br /&gt;
* /toggledownfall&lt;br /&gt;
* /weather&lt;br /&gt;
* /whitelist&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Scenarios ===&lt;br /&gt;
The following commands are related to scenarios. These are usually settings that can be changed. You can run these commands before enabling the scenario, but you still have to enable the scenario from the /scen command.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==== Apple Drop Rate ====&lt;br /&gt;
* /appledroprate [percentage] (decimals allowed)&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==== Emergency Call ====&lt;br /&gt;
* /emergencycall charge [time] : it sets the amount of time it will take for /ecall to teleport team mates&lt;br /&gt;
* /emergencycall cooldown [time] : it sets the cooldown time for /ecall&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==== Flint Drop Rate ====&lt;br /&gt;
* /flintdroprate [percentage] (decimals allowed)&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==== Floor is Lava ====&lt;br /&gt;
* /floorislava seconds [seconds]: it sets the time between lava rises&lt;br /&gt;
* /floorislava height [y-coordinate]: it sets the y coordinate where the lava will rise to next&lt;br /&gt;
* /floorislava maxheight [y-coordinate]: it sets the maximum y coordinate the lava will rise. Lava will stop rising at the specified y coordinate&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==== Mystery Scenarios ====&lt;br /&gt;
* /mscen time (time): changes the time between Mystery Scenarios, (e.g. /mscen time 5m for 5 minutes between scenarios)&lt;br /&gt;
* /mscen amount (amount): changes the amount of scenarios to enable (e.g. /mscen amount 5 will enable 5 scenarios instead of the default 3)&lt;br /&gt;
* /mscen change: changes the current scenarios to random ones and resets the timer&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Cheat Mode ===&lt;br /&gt;
Cheat mode let you to run commands that can be potentially used to &amp;quot;cheat&amp;quot;. You can enable this mode with the &#039;&#039;&#039;/cheatmode&#039;&#039;&#039; command. Once you enable it, all players will receive a notification of your change. Cheatmode cannot be disabled once it has been enabled.&lt;br /&gt;
This is a list of commands that the host can run while cheat mode is enabled:&lt;br /&gt;
* /effect&lt;br /&gt;
* /gamemode&lt;br /&gt;
* /give&lt;br /&gt;
* /kill&lt;br /&gt;
* /tp&lt;br /&gt;
* /xp&lt;/div&gt;</summary>

===Beaconwatch===&lt;br /&gt;
Collect resources from the map and purchase stained glass with the required items from the village trader and defend the glass after placing it in the middle until the timer runs out!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 15 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Block Dash===&lt;br /&gt;
On each round, you will receive an item. Move to a matching block to avoid falling into lava!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 5 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Block Memory===&lt;br /&gt;
On each round, the platforms will reveal block types for a short period of time then you will receive an item. Move to a matching block to avoid falling lava!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 5 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Hide and Seek===&lt;br /&gt;
Players are split into two teams: Hiders and Seekers. The Hiders will hide within the map while the Seekers look for the Hiders.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 8 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Payload===&lt;br /&gt;
Push your team’s Minecart by standing close to it. Stop the opposing team’s Minecart from progressing. Reach and defend your Minecart at the goal Minecart to win!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 15 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Survival Games===&lt;br /&gt;
Up to 24 players fight against each other with the items they can find in the chest placed around the map! An airdrop chest drops from the sky. Locate it with a compass! At 6 minutes into the game, the border will quickly shrink towards the center.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 10 minutes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Treasure Hunters===&lt;br /&gt;
Collect the items in the “required items” list, put the items in a chest, and use the firework to launch the chest! The first player to launch all the required items or have the most items launched at the end of the game wins!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Typical game length: 30 minutes&lt;/div&gt;</summary>

&lt;div&gt;These are the sign commands available on the Creative Build Server.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
* Colored signs: type &amp;quot;&amp;amp;&amp;quot; followed by the color of your choice using Minecraft&#039;s color codes. [[File:Colored signs.jpg|thumb|Colored sign example]]&lt;br /&gt;
* Give experience levels: line 1: &amp;quot;giveexp&amp;quot;, line 2: (positive amount) [[File:Giving 500 experience levels example.jpg|thumb|Giving 500 xp levels example]]&lt;br /&gt;
* Give item [once]: line 1: &amp;quot;give&amp;quot;, line 2: ([https://helpch.at/docs/1.8.8/org/bukkit/Material.html item]) [[File:Give item (once).png|thumb|Giving a single diamond (once) example]]&lt;br /&gt;
* Messages [only to the player who accesses it]: line 1: &amp;quot;msg&amp;quot;, lines 2-4: (message) [Note: doing %PN makes the message say the player&#039;s name] [[File:Message signs.png|thumb|Message on a sign example]]&lt;br /&gt;
* Potion effects: line 1: &amp;quot;effect&amp;quot;, line 2: (potion effect), line 3: (duration), line 4: (level [#0-4]) [Note: not all the effects work] [[File:Regeneration effect sign.jpg|thumb|Regeneration III effect example]]&lt;br /&gt;
* Remove experience levels: line 1: &amp;quot;giveexp&amp;quot;, line 2: (negative amount) [[File:Removing experience levels.png|thumb|Removing experience levels example]]&lt;br /&gt;
* Return to checkpoint: &amp;quot;cp&amp;quot;&lt;br /&gt;
* Set block: line 1: &amp;quot;setblockr&amp;quot;, line 2: &amp;quot;(x,y,z)&amp;quot; of the desired block change, line 3: ( block)&lt;br /&gt;
* Set checkpoint: &amp;quot;setcp&amp;quot;&lt;br /&gt;
* Sound effects: line 1: &amp;quot;sound&amp;quot;, line 2: ([https://helpch.at/docs/1.8.8/org/bukkit/Sound.html sound effect])&lt;br /&gt;
* Teleporting players: line 1: &amp;quot;tpr&amp;quot;, line 2: (x-coordinate), line 3: (y-coordinate) line 4: (z-coordinate)&lt;/div&gt;</summary>

&lt;div&gt;On the Creative Build server, there are several commands available for players including:&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Island commands:&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
* /clear: clears the player&#039;s inventory [Note: you can also do /clearinventory]&lt;br /&gt;
* /entrytrust (name): Allows someone to be able to visit your plot [Note: specify &amp;quot;public&amp;quot; to allow everyone]&lt;br /&gt;
* /gma, /gmc, /gmp, /gms: These control the game mode a player is in [Adventure, Creative, Spectator, and Survival in preceding order]&lt;br /&gt;
* /is home (name): Teleports to your own plot, or the specified player&#039;s plot&lt;br /&gt;
* /is reset: Resets your plot&lt;br /&gt;
* /trust (name): Allows someone to build on your plot&lt;br /&gt;
* /trustlist: Check who has been trusted&lt;br /&gt;
* /untrust (name): Removes someone from the trust list&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
WorldEdit commands:&lt;br /&gt;
* //contract: Contracts the selected area&lt;br /&gt;
* //copy: Copies the blocks between the selected area&lt;br /&gt;
* //cut: removes all the blocks in the selected area&lt;br /&gt;
* //expand: Expands the selected area&lt;br /&gt;
* //paste: Pastes the blocks copied from the selected area&lt;br /&gt;
* //replace (original block) (new block): Replace all blocks in the selection with another &lt;br /&gt;
* //set (pattern): Sets the blocks between pos1 and pos2 to a new block [Note: &amp;quot;pattern&amp;quot; is the block that&#039;s used]&lt;br /&gt;
* //setbiome (biome): Sets the biome of the region&lt;br /&gt;
* //sphere &amp;lt;pattern&amp;gt; &amp;lt;radius&amp;gt;[,&amp;lt;radius&amp;gt;,&amp;lt;radius&amp;gt;] [raised?]: Creates a sphere with the parameters you set&lt;br /&gt;
* //wand: Provides a wooden axe to help with WorldEditing&lt;br /&gt;
[Note: left click with a wooden axe to set &amp;quot;pos1&amp;quot; and right click to set &amp;quot;pos2&amp;quot;]&lt;br /&gt;

Welcome to the PlayUHC and PlayMCG Wiki. Here you will find all information about our network and about UHC as a game mode.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
UHC stands for &amp;quot;ultra hardcore&amp;quot; which ultimately means that you do not naturally gain your hearts back when you take damage unless you use a golden apple or a healing potion. The overall goal of a UHC game is to survive hardcore mode by defeating the other players that are in the game through PvP (Player vs Player). &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
MCG stands for &amp;quot;Minecraft games&amp;quot;, where you can find the Survival multiplayer server, and several minigames.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
PlayUHC and PlayMCG are strictly linked together, and you have shared statistics between them. You can also quickly move from one server to the other without having to switch server address.&lt;br /&gt;
